    Never heard of them until just now. From their website they look like a start-up service. No past records, nothing documented on the net. Not even any past info on their website. Just a storyline and them asking for money.

    It sounds like a pretty good deal however it could all just be marketing...it all depends on if they are legit in keeping their word. It might be worth testing the waters but I wouldn't bank on them returning your money if they don't hit 60%...

    FYI - Here is the OP as mrjenkins462 shilling this service in another thread.

    The fact that he needed 2 accounts to try to drum up business, polluting the same thread - and attempted to create more but those were banned automatically - would have me very hesitant about giving this guy a cent. Let alone believing he'll be around to give me a refund. My advice would be to let his multiple personalities build up a record first and see if this guy is actually legit.
